The "safe harbor" regulations describe various payment and business practices that, while potentially infringing on the Federal anti-kickback statute, are not considered offenses under the statute.
The Code of Federal Rules (CFR) is the codification of general and permanent regulations made by the executive departments and agencies of the United States federal government. The CFR is organized into 50 titles that reflect large sectors regulated by the federal government.
The Office of the Federal Register (part of the National Archives and Records Administration) and the Government Publishing Office publish the CFR annual edition as a special issue of the Federal Register.
The CFR is also published online on the Electronic CFR (eCFR) website, which is updated daily, in addition to the annual edition.
